Which early hominid species is believed to be first to leave africa?
m_a_m_a [10]

Homo ergaster may have been the first human species to leave Africa and fossil remains show this species had expanded its range into southern Eurasia by 1.75 million years ago. Their descendents, Homo erectus, then spread eastward and were established in South East Asia by at least 1.6 million years ago.Oct 30, 2015
